Output 7a15714cbb26cae7ccdfe1c8c0499bccaf23f728e6497aab733e0c560588244a:1

value
2859118
script pubkey
OP_0 OP_PUSHBYTES_20 b95eecbc22cc0bbbc869ace85e488e7d0cbbb83b
address
bc1qh90we0pzes9mhjrf4n59ujyw05xthwpmjdmjv8
transaction
7a15714cbb26cae7ccdfe1c8c0499bccaf23f728e6497aab733e0c560588244a
spent
true